料浆法磷铵中和与浓缩的优化工艺设计  被引量:2

Optimal Neutralization and Concentration Process Design of Ammonium Phosphate Based on Slurry Process

摘  要:在料浆法磷铵生产装置的设计中,以强制循环中和新工艺代替旧的槽式中和反应工艺,将中和与浓缩结合起来进行优化工艺设计,利用反应中产生的蒸汽与一效蒸发浓缩产生的二次蒸汽混合后共同作为二效蒸发浓缩的热源,从而节省大量能源,取得节能减排的双重效果。In the design of ammonium phosphate production unit based on slurry process,the new process of forced circulation neutralization replaces the old tank neutralization reaction process,which greatly reduces ammonia losses,improves the environment,simplifies the process flow and saves investment. The combination of neutralization and concentration optimizes the process design,making use of steam produced in the reaction mixed with the secondary steam generated from the 1st effective evaporation concentration to act as the heat source of 2nd effective evaporation and concentration,thus saving a lot of energy and achieving double effect of energy saving and emission reduction.
